During London Collections: Men I was invited down to The Hospital Club for an intimate screening of Zoolander with leading UK male model David Gandy.  The screening was to launch Red Nose Day’s ‘Blue Steel’ appeal, a series of fashion events and initiatives which will take place across 2013, bringing the fashion industry and great British public together for some very stylish Red Nose Day fun.

The first “Blue Steel Appeal” event will be a big fashion auction on eBay on 7th March auctioning a selection of money-can’t-buy fashion items and experiences donated by some of fashion’s most iconic brands and individuals.

David said about the appeal, “Having seen first hand the challenges people face in the UK and across the world I wanted to do something to help. After working briefly with Comic Relief on the Absolutely Fabulous sketch with Kate Moss and Stella McCartney last year, I decided to launch the “Blue Steel Appeal” to fundraise for Red Nose Day through fashion. I hope that the fashion industry will come together, have some fun, show off their best Blue Steel looks and raise money at the same time. There are truly wonderful people in the industry and it would be great to show the public the lighter side of what we do and encourage them to join us in fundraising. If we all rally together, I know we can really help a lot of people.”
